Seasons
During the summer months the weather is hot and moist and heavy rains are a
common characteristic throughout this season. The highest average temperature
during summer reaches 29ºC. On the other hand, the winter months see
temperatures dropping slightly with the highest average temperature being 19ºC
and the lowest 12ºC. The Buzios climate sees little alteration, and when
travellers holiday to Buzios it’s more a matter of choosing between action and
crowds, or having a serene vacation with ample space on the beach. Tourists who
want avoid the crowds and spend time soaking up the sunlight are best to travel
between the months of March
to June or September to November. Holidaying out of this time (peak season) does
guarantee Buzios’ supreme weather forecasts, but the ratio of tourists to every
local is four to one.
Sea Temperatures and Rainfall
The majority of rainfall in Buzios is usually intermittent, but the area is branded to fall victim to unexpected storms which can last several days. During this time wind speed can go up over 50 km/h and the wind direction just tends to come from ubiquitously at once. For most of the year however the Buzios weather is clement, with relative humidity that is tolerable to most Westerners. The temperature of the water throughout the coast will be quite varied, especially if you’re on the east coast instead of the west, but is generally in the range of 18 ºC to 21ºC.
The beaches on the Eastern coast experience a fairly long high tide.
Information about tidal range can be found at any surf shop, tourist
information booth or at the reception of most hotels. There is generally no
“bad” time to visit Buzios, as the Buzios weather is typically calm and warm
all-year round. However, violent storms can come out of nowhere and there is
actually no valid way in predicting them. Tourists need to make sure they pack
at least a rain coat (no need for an umbrella, it will simply get shattered by
the wind) in the unlikely event of an unexpected storm.
